Ambiance: 9/10
Our party of 7 arrived just after our scheduled reservation time, (8:30 Saturday) and the staff was very accomodating and understanding of our tardiness. Fortunately, the night had just begun and the restaurant was not too packed yet. There was a fun neon light fixture in the shape of angel's wings for a photo opportunity as well. We were treated with an impressive fireshow with nearly every table getting two+ sparklers to join in on the fun. The only reason this isn't a 5/5 experience was because of how much smoke came off the sparklers. At one moment, it became hard to breathe and a napkin was used to try to filter the air as some of us started coughing and rubbing our eyes.

Food: 4/10
Every table started off with some chips and some salsa. I love spicy food and the salsa did not disappoint. Our party started off with a Peruvian Ceviche (450 MXD) and a RosaNegra salad for the table, both of which were stellar. I loved the freshness of the fish and the salad was well-dressed and not drowned in dressing. We also had a bone marrow dish which looked amazing, but I didn't have any for myself. I ended up ordering the shrimp risotto (1100 MXD) and I was rather disappointed by the risotto. To clarify, it was really rich and creamy, but was only given two shrimp on top. My friends ordered the steak risotto and the mushroom risotto as well, and I came to find out that the base is exactly the same. The only difference was in the toppings which defined the dish. This may be too much to expect, but I was certainly hoping for the taste of shrimp in my shrimp risotto, the taste of mushroom in the mushroom risotto, and the taste of beef in the steak risotto. Instead we were served a standard risotto base with different toppings. I will say though that the shrimp and steak were well seasoned and not over-cooked.
